Disadvantages of Pre-made Themes

The fastest and least expensive way to build a website is to use one of the pre-made themes available through a CMS. A custom theme, on the other hand, will take weeks to design and implement and it will cost significantly more. It’s quite common for smaller businesses with limited resources to opt for the cheaper, quicker pre-made template just to get things going. The problem is, there may be hundreds of other non-related businesses and even competitors using the same theme. Saving a few dollars up front can have a detrimental impact on the business’s brand image by creating confusion among prospects and customers.

Website Speed

Pre-made themes are designed to appeal to the masses. The designers of these themes try to include as much functionality as possible so that users have some level of control over the configuration of their site. This causes the site’s load time to be extremely slow. Visitors won’t stick around to wait and Google’s algorithms will pick up on it and the site’s ranking will fall. A custom theme only contains the functions that are necessary. That means the site loads faster making visitors and Google much happier with it.

Flexibility and Scalability

One of the major downfalls of pre-made themes is that they aren’t very flexible or scalable. The needs of a business and its website change over time and a theme that can’t grow with it is a liability. For example, if the site’s traffic dramatically increases and the theme can’t handle it, customers will be lost and business will suffer. A custom designed theme, on the other hand, can be created with growth in mind. This allows the company to add functionality as it’s needed without having to start all over from scratch.

Admin Experience

pre-made themes, as mentioned previously, come with a ton of features designed to appeal to as many people as possible. The problem with that is all of the administration functions for those features are crammed into the back end. It’s incredibly difficult to wade through all of the settings to find the right ones and to make adjustments. A custom theme only contains the functions that are necessary for the admin without all the bloat. That makes the webmaster’s job much easier, faster, and more efficient.
